Job Requirements
- 5+ years of DevOps/SRE experience (2+ years with production AWS), with strong expertise in EC2, ECS, RDS/Aurora, VPC, S3, IAM, and CloudWatch.
- Deep experience with Terraform and IaC, plus strong CI/CD skills (CircleCI preferred) and modern deployment patterns (blue/green, canary, feature flags).
- Strong containerization, automation, and scripting abilities (Docker, ECS, Ruby/Python/Go/Bash).
- Hands-on observability and Linux systems engineering experience, including performance tuning, monitoring, logging, and secure configuration.
- Security and compliance background, ideally in fintech or regulated environments (SOC 2, PCI, ISO 27001), with an understanding of IAM, encryption, secrets mgmt, and secure architecture.
- Proven incident leadership, collaboration skills, and a track record of reducing operational toil through automation.
